January 30, 201610 yr Interesting Bert. Do you feel that step might overcome the stuttering I experience when I config a 2nd GTN 750 into the Real Air Duke V2? Are there any other core use settings that need to be made to FSX or anything else to compensate or offset the GTN assignment? This will differ depending on how you have your flightsim configured.. try some different Core settings for the two GTN units and see if it helps.. In my case, I have FSX running on the last three cores of a quad processor with HT off. In the F1GTN.ini file, I have the GTN set to CPU Core=all. And I only run one GTN unit in the panel. That works for me.. YMMV.. Bert
